
George Kirby and Doreen Luckie have been together 27 years, and are the best of friends. They have 7 children, 15 grandchildren and 7 great-grandchildren between them. But only recently did the couple decide to take the final step in their relationship and get married.
On Valentine's Day, over dinner, George finally popped the question. Doreen accepted his proposal, and the couple set their wedding date for June 13th, George's birthday... his 103rd birthday, that is!
By tying the knot at 103 and 91, respectively, George and Doreen will officially become the "World's Oldest Newlyweds," according to the Guinness World Records. The couple met through an organization that helps seniors connect.
George, a former boxer, physical education instructor, restaurant manager, and gardener, was 76, and recently-divorced when he met Doreen, who had formerly been a typist. Doreen had lost her husband three years earlier. There was an immediate connection between George and Doreen, and they began seeing each other regularly, eventually moving in together. Now, after a little pressure from their children, the two have finally decided to make it official. “I suppose it’s about time, really," George said. "I definitely don’t feel my age. Doreen keeps me young."
Young he might feel, but when it came to the proposal, George decided to opt out of the traditional routine. “I didn’t get down on one knee, because I didn't think I would've been able to get back up,” George laughed.
The couple will be married at the hotel, owned by George's son, Neil, where they now live. Neil, 63, who will be best man, noted that George and Doreen are “very much in love with each other." This is one couple that knows how to enjoy life, regardless of advanced age!
